'Eusebius on TimesLIVE' hosted an energetic debate about controversial limited-edition sneakers released by Balenciaga.
hosted an energetic debate about controversial limited-edition sneakers released by Balenciaga.
The “distressed” design, which looks like very dirty, well-worn shoes that only people under conditions of extreme poverty may be reluctantly compelled to wear, retails at about $1,850 .on whether the dirty and broken sneakers could be considered art.
